Being the only ski-in and ski-out hotel in Bansko, Kempinski Hotel Grand Arena Bansko is located in the very heart of the mountain resort, right across the Gondola elevator station.

The hotel would certainly not be described as modern - the decor, furnishings, everything - is old and heavy in style, but not in a bad way. Lots of wood, dark carpets etc. The feeling is perhaps of old charm.
The rooms are large'ish - huge comfy bed, large super heated bathroom with both shower and bath. Luxurious hot water. Thermostat in the room works perfectly - you can be as warm as you like. Our (standard) room had a large balcony facing the slope & mountains. Beautiful view when the fog lifts.
The spa services within the hotel are fantastic - a large indoor pool, indoor and outdoor Jacuzzi and a good sized outdoor pool - where you can swim in hot water with the snow all around. A delightful experience!
The location is second to none - for skiing in Bansko it can't be beat. It is right across from the Gondola - 30-40 meters walk in the snow from the ski shop rental within the hotel where you exit directly to the snow.
Hotel restaurants are supposed to be very good but expensive. We did not book the full board option but sampled the local restaurants - there's plenty of great options to choose from in walking distance.
As a tip I would suggest - rent your ski equipment in the hotel (the convenience is more than worth it) but buy your ski pass at the gondola. The hotel is happy to sell you the lift tickets with your equipment but they charge a premium of about 20 euro a day per person.
Wifi works great.
Hotel staff are pleasant and helpful - overall a great experience.
The following are minor issues that could be improved.
Not enough electrical outlets in the room. Although there is an outlet on each bedside, with multiple items to charge that's not enough. An outlet is especially lacking at the (long and convenient) desk. I imagine I'm not the only person who wanted to plug in their laptop (I had to unplug the TV).
Also - if there was a way to get Netflix on the (large flatscreen) TV - I didn't find it. This day and age I find it surprising when hotels do not provide built in access to streaming services. Allow folks to connect their own account & wipe it when they leave.

Our stay at the Kempinski Hotel was enjoyable overall, and I'd like to share a few highlights:
Breakfast: The breakfast offerings were impressive, with a wide variety of choices available. I especially appreciated the option to order fresh eggs and the selection of fresh coffee and tea.
Swimming Pools: The swimming pools were fantastic, and my kids absolutely loved spending time there. It was great to be able to order snacks and drinks while relaxing at the venue.
Restaurant: The restaurant was excellent. The staff were incredibly helpful and had a positive attitude, which made our dining experience even better.
Rooms: The rooms were spacious, clean, and well-maintained. I reserved a mountain view room, which was cleaned daily as per my preference.
I do have some concerns regarding the air conditioning system. While I understand that the hotel is primarily a winter skiing resort, it's important to provide adequate cooling for guests during the summer months. Unfortunately, the air conditioning in our room was a significant issue. The room was uncomfortably warm, and despite setting the thermostat to the coolest temperature, the A/C did not perform as expected. When I contacted the hotel staff, they mentioned that the minimum temperature is set to 21 degrees Celsius, but it was clear that the cooling system was not functioning properly. This greatly affected our comfort, particularly during the night.
I hope my feedback is helpful, and I strongly recommend that the hotel reviews its air conditioning policies and systems to ensure a comfortable stay for guests during warmer months.
